MQ-9 Airmen expand horizons, integrate into community
MQ-9 Reaper mobile cockpits began arriving at Shaw Air Force Base, S.C., following Secretary of the Air Force Heather Wilson’s approval for the base to host a new MQ-9 group, Jan. 10, 2018. During the first phase of the project, the installation of mobile cockpits and small office facilities enabled basic work capabilities for Airmen supporting the arriving remotely piloted aircraft mission.
